.normal,div,span,p,td,th,li,a{font-family:Arial, Helvetica, sans-serif;font-size:12px;}

body {
	background-color: #344C36;
	background-image: url(bodybg_y.jpg);
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	margin: 0px;
	padding: 0px;
	height: 100%;
	width: 100%;
	background-position: 0px -14px;
}

#bodybgtop {
	background-image: url(bodybg_x2.jpg);
	background-repeat: repeat-x;
	height: 100%;
	width: 100%;
}
td {
font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
}
a:link {
	color: #1C397B;
}
a:visited {
	color: #1C397B;
}
a:hover {
	color: #FF9C00;
}
#page {
	width: 980px;
	font-size: 12px;
}
td {
font-size: 12px;
}
.leftpane {
	width: 236px;
	background-color: #FFFFFF;
	background-image: url(ib_content2bg.jpg);
	background-repeat: repeat-x;
	border-top-width: 1px;
	border-right-width: 1px;
	border-bottom-width: 1px;
	border-top-style: solid;
	border-right-style: solid;
	border-bottom-style: solid;
	border-left-style: none;
	border-top-color: #666666;
	border-right-color: #666666;
	border-bottom-color: #666666;
	margin-right: 13px;
}

.contentpane {
	background-color: #FFFFFF;
	border-right-width: 1px;
	border-bottom-width: 1px;
	border-left-width: 1px;
	border-top-style: none;
	border-right-style: solid;
	border-bottom-style: solid;
	border-left-style: solid;
	border-right-color: #666666;
	border-bottom-color: #666666;
	border-left-color: #666666;
	width: 703px;
	padding-top: 13px;
	padding-right: 13px;
	padding-bottom: 13px;
	padding-left: 13px;
	margin: 0px;
	font-size: 12px;
}


#clearfloat {
	clear: both;
	margin: 0px;
	padding: 0px;
	height: 1px;
	width: 1px;
}

#header1 {
	width: 980px;
	height: 94px;
	margin: 0px;
	padding: 0px;
}

.footerpane {
	padding: 10px;
	background-color: #333333;
	text-align: center;
	height: auto;
	min-height:1px;
	margin-top: 0px;
	margin-right: 0px;
	margin-bottom: 15px;
	margin-left: 0px;
}

.linkspane {
	padding: 10px;
	height: auto;
	min-height:1px;
}

.FCKImageGalleryContainer {background-color: #fff;}
.FCKLinkGalleryContainer {background-color: #fff;}

/*text*/

.head,.subhead{font-family: Arial, Helvetica, sans-serif;color:#333;}
.head{font-size:16px;font-weight:bold;}


/*links & buttons*/
a:link{color:#005696;text-decoration:underline;}
a:visited{color:#005696;text-decoration:underline;}
a:hover{color:#005696;text-decoration:none;}
a:active{color:#005696;text-decoration:none;}

.StandardButton{background:#CCC;border:1px #CCC outset;padding:5px;}

a.CommandButton{font-size:14px;font-weight:bold;}
.controlpanel a.CommandButton{font-size:10px;}
a.CommandButton:link{color:#005696;text-decoration:none;}
a.CommandButton:visited{color:#005696;text-decoration:none;}
a.CommandButton:hover{color:#005696;text-decoration:underline;}
a.CommandButton:active{color:#005696;text-decoration:underline;}

a.skinuser:link{color:#005696;text-decoration:none;}
a.skinuser:visited{color:#005696;text-decoration:none;}
a.skinuser:hover{color:#000;text-decoration:underline;}
a.skinuser:active{color:#000;text-decoration:underline;}

h1, h2, h3, h4, h5, h6 {	font-family: Arial,sans-serif;}
h1{ font-size: 150%; color: #000;}
h2{ font-size: 18px;
	color: #000;
	border-bottom-width: 1px;
	border-bottom-style: solid;
	border-bottom-color: #CCCCCC;
	font-weight:bold;
	margin-top: 10px;
	}
h3{ font-size: 16px;color: #000;font-weight:bold;}
h4{ font-size: 125%; color: #003084; font-weight: bold;}
h5{ font-size: 100%; color: #003084;}

.headerfooter {color:#fff;}
a.headerfooter:link{color:#fff;text-decoration:none;}
a.headerfooter:visited{color:#fff;text-decoration:none;}
a.headerfooter:hover{color:#fff;text-decoration:underline;}
a.headerfooter:active{color:#fff;text-decoration:underline;}

/* Solpart Menu */

*:first-child+html .MainMenu_MenuContainer { margin: 0 0 1px 20px;} * html .MainMenu_MenuContainer { margin: 0 0 1px 20px;}
/* IE needs an extra space in the bottom margin in order to show the bottom line of the buttons. */

.MainMenu_MenuContainer { margin: 0 0 0 20px; } 

.MainMenu_MenuContainer td { } 

.MainMenu_MenuBar { 
height:22px;} 

.MainMenu_MenuItem { 
border:0; 
font-family:Arial, Helvetica, sans-serif;
color: #1C397B;
font-size:12px;
font-weight:normal;
padding:0 10px;
height:22px;
} 
/* this font-family changes the sub menus only */
/* this background modifies the main menu and the sub menus */
/* height here modifies the main menu and the sub menu */
/* border here changes the sub menus only */
/* padding here changes the sub menus only */
/* color here changes the sub menu font */

.MainMenu_MenuItem td{ 
} 

.MainMenu_MenuItem td span{ } 

.MainMenu_MenuIcon { 
display: none; } 

/* Main Menu Active/Current Button */
.rootmenuitemactive{

}

/* Main Menu Mouseover */
.MainMenu_MenuItemSel {  } 

/* Padding around the words in the main menu buttons */
.MainMenu_MenuItemSel td{ 

} 

.MainMenu_MenuBreak {
display:none; } 

.MainMenu_RootMenuArrow {
display:none; } 

/* Shows up in the sub menu, to the right of the words. */
.MainMenu_MenuArrow{
display:none; 
}  

.submenu{
z-index:1000;
border:0;
background:#fff;
font-weight:normal;
border-right: 1px solid #ccc;
border-left: 1px solid #ccc;
border-bottom: 1px solid #ccc;
border-top: 0;
} 

/* Sub Menu Mouseover */
.submenuitemselected{
background:#fff;
font-family:Arial, Helvetica, sans-serif;
color: orange;
text-decoration:underline;
font-size:12px;
font-weight:normal;
border:0;
padding:0 10px;
}

/* Sub Menu Active/Current */
.submenuitembreadcrumb{
font-family:Arial, Helvetica, sans-serif;
font-size:12px;
padding:0 10px;
}

.rootmenuitem{
background:transparent;}  

.rootmenuitem td{
border:0;
width:135px;
text-align:center;
background:url(button_on.gif) no-repeat top right;
height:22px;
padding:0;
}  
/* Add width here to set main nav button width */ 
/* Add images here for button background */ 
/* if you don't put the height here, the right border doesnt reach the top/bottom. */
/* Also adds (unwanted) border in the submenu. */ 

/* Main Menu font */ 
.rootmenuitem td span{
font-family:Arial, Helvetica, sans-serif;
color:#8890a2;
font-size:12px;
font-weight:bold;
}  

.rootmenuitembreadcrumb{
background:transparent;
} 

/* Main Menu Mouseover */ 
.rootmenuitembreadcrumb td{
background:url(button.gif) no-repeat top right;
height:22px;
padding:0;
width:135px;
text-align:center;
} 

/* Main Menu Active/Current button */
.rootmenuitembreadcrumb td span{
font-family:Arial, Helvetica, sans-serif;
color:#000;
font-size:12px;
font-weight:bold;}  

/* Main Menu Mouseover Background */
.rootmenuitemselected{
background:#005696;
}  

.rootmenuitemselected td{
background:url(button.gif) no-repeat top right;
height:22px;
padding:0;
width:135px;
text-align:center;
/* Add images here for selected button background */ 
}  

/* Main Menu Mouseover Text */
.rootmenuitemselected td span{
font-family:Arial, Helvetica, sans-serif;
color:#000;
font-size:12px;
font-weight:bold;}  



#menu1 {
        width: 100%;
        margin:-10px 0 0 0;
        border:0;
		padding:0;
        }
		
#menu1 ul {
margin: 0;
padding: 0;
}

#menu1 li a {
        height: 23px;
          voice-family: "\"}\"";
          voice-family: inherit;
          height: 23px;
		  line-height: 23px;
        text-decoration: none;
		font-size:11px;
		font-weight:bold;
        }

#menu1 li a:link, #menu1 li a:visited {
        color: #1C397B;
        display: block;
        padding: 0 0 0 38px;
		border-bottom:1px solid #9a6b38;
        }

#menu1 li a:hover, #menu1 li #current {
        color: #FFF;
        padding: 0 0 0 38px;
		background: #B43017 url(orange.gif);
        }
		
#menu1 li #current {
background: #003466 url(blue.gif);
padding: 0 0 0 30px;
}

#menu1 ul li {
  list-style-type: none;
}
